Sound Point Capital Management, a New York based credit-oriented investment manager overseeing approximately $44 billion in total assets, is seeking a Senior Associate or Vice President of Wealth Distribution. The Firm has expertise in credit strategies and manages money on behalf of institutions, pensions, foundations, insurance companies, wealth management firms, family offices and high net worth individuals. Our strategies span the spectrum of liquid and illiquid credit alternatives and includes funds and managed accounts focused on leveraged loans, CLOs, Opportunistic Credit, Private Credit, Structured Credit and Real Estate Credit.
